    Starting Off

    transitioning to healthy natural hair
    "I want my beautiful natural healthy hair"
    Write down why you want your hair to be natural so when the going gets tuff you can have something to look back at to motivate you to keep natural.
    TO HAVE A GOOD TRANSITION YOU MUST FIRST:
    COMMIT TO THE PROCESS
    START WITH WHERE YOUR AT
    BUY YOUR STAPLE PRODUCTS(PRODUCTS THAT WORK BEST WITH BOTH HAIR TEXTURES)
    FOCUS ON MASTERING ONE STYLE AT A TIME
    tips for a smooth transition:
    use sulfate free shampoos
    detangle from ends to root
    minimal styling
    deep condition every other week
    keep hair moisturized using a water based product
    DO NOT USE HEAT REPEATEDLEY (ONCE A WEEK OR ONCE A MONTH ON LOW HEAT)
    DONT BRUSH OR COMB DRY HAIR
    be gentle
    be patient
    be open-minded
    be flexible
    be observant
    co-wash-applying only conditioner no shampoo
    co-wash once a week
    shampoo atleast once every two weeks
    Detangling:
    conditioner in hair
    seperate into four sections
    condition each section
    start from ends of hair up
    AVOID PRODUTS WITH THESE INGREDIENTS:
    ALCHOOL
    MINERAL OIL, PERTOLATUM(PETROLEUM)
    POLYETHYIENE GLYCOL, PROPLENE GLYCOL
    SLS,SLES
    DIMETHITHICONE AND OTHER "CONES"

    HAIR STYLES TO TRY:
    ROLLER SETS
    BRAID-OUTS
    TWIST-OUTS
    BANTU KNOT-OUTS
    MICRO BRAIDS
    MICRO TWISTS
    KINKY TWISTS
    SEW-IN-WEAVE
    USE SULFATE FREE SHAMPOO,SILICONE FREE CONDITIONER
